There seems to be a bug with RFC822 processing in ltmp proxying that doesn't quote local parts that, for example, contain spaces.
director config: director_username_hash = %Ln lmtp_proxy = yes recipient_delimiter = + protocol lmtp { auth_socket_path = director-userdb auth_username_chars = auth_username_format = %Ln passdb { driver = sql args = /etc/director/sql.d/lmtp.ext result_failure = return-fail result_internalfail = return-fail } } lmtp.ext: password_query = SELECT 'y' AS proxy, NULL AS password, 'y' AS nopassword FROM users WHERE userName='%Ln' from exim -> director LMTP network dump: MAIL FROM:<t...@testdomain.com>\r\n RCPT TO:<"deemzed.uk+Junk E-mail"@mailbox.localhost>\r\n DATA\r\n (etc) .\r\n 501 5.5.4 Invalid parameters\r\n QUIT\r\n from director -> dovecot LMTP network dump: MAIL FROM:<t...@testdomain.com>\r\n RCPT TO:<deemzed.uk+Junk E-mail>\r\n 501 5.5.4 Invalid.parameters\r\n I'll try to pare down a full config for doveconf that displays this behaviour if required, as currently I have sensitive/extraneous information in there, but this seems fairly cut and dried as a bug to me. -- Dave
